Our client is looking for a Team Administrator to join their friendly and supportive team. This is an excellent opportunity for someone with previous administration experience who is looking to develop their career within financial services.
What you'll be doing:
- Supporting the team with a variety of day-to-day administrative tasks.
- Scheduling meetings with advisers and stakeholders, including arranging Microsoft Teams and face-to-face meetings.
- Collecting, tracking and managing documentation, ensuring deadlines are met.
- Maintaining accurate compliance records, databases and management information.
- Logging and processing complaints in line with company procedures.
- Managing the e-learning platform and ensuring training records remain up to date.
- Coordinating departmental meetings and training sessions.
- Arranging travel and accommodation for members of the team.
- Raising purchase orders and supporting departmental procurement.
- Maintaining professional accreditation records and ensuring documentation is stored securely.
- Working closely with colleagues across the business to support regulatory and compliance activities.
- Providing general administrative support to the wider department as required.
What we're looking for:
- Previous experience in an administrative or business support role.
- Experience within financial services would be advantageous but is not essential.
- Excellent organisational skills with strong attention to detail.
- Confident communicator, both written and verbal.
- Strong IT skills, including Microsoft Office.
- Ability to manage multiple tasks and prioritise workload effectively.
- A proactive, reliable and professional approach to work.
- Someone who enjoys working as part of a collaborative team while also being able to work independently.
